MARKET INSIGHTS

Global Hypophosphatemia Treatment market size was valued at USD 27.1 million in 2024. The market is projected to grow from USD 28.6 million in 2025 to USD 39.5 million by 2032, exhibiting a CAGR of 5.6% during the forecast period.

Hypophosphatemia is a clinical condition characterized by abnormally low levels of phosphate in the blood (serum inorganic phosphorus concentration below 0.8 mmol/L or 2.5 mg/dL). While mild cases may be asymptomatic, severe hypophosphatemia can lead to serious complications including muscle weakness, respiratory failure, and cardiac dysfunction. The condition affects individuals across all age groups and demographics.

The market growth is primarily driven by increasing awareness of phosphate metabolism disorders and expanding therapeutic options. While the condition was traditionally managed through dietary modifications, recent years have seen significant pharmaceutical advancements, particularly in intravenous phosphate replacement therapies. Leading companies such as Kyowa Kirin and Ultragenyx Pharmaceutical have introduced novel treatment formulations, contributing to market expansion. However, the relatively low prevalence of severe cases and high treatment costs present ongoing challenges for market penetration.

MARKET DYNAMICS

MARKET DRIVERS

Rising Prevalence of Chronic Kidney Disease and Genetic Disorders to Accelerate Market Growth

The global hypophosphatemia treatment market is experiencing significant growth due to the increasing prevalence of chronic kidney disease (CKD) and genetic disorders like X-linked hypophosphatemia (XLH). CKD alone affects approximately 10% of the global population, with many patients developing secondary hypophosphatemia as a complication. Additionally, XLH occurs in about 1 in 20,000 live births, creating a consistent demand for phosphate supplements and specialized treatments. Pharmaceutical companies are responding with targeted therapies, such as Kyowa Kirin's burosumab, which received FDA approval for XLH treatment, demonstrating the market's potential for innovation-driven growth.

Advancements in Orphan Drug Development to Stimulate Market Expansion

Orphan drug designation for rare diseases like hereditary hypophosphatemic rickets is creating lucrative opportunities in the treatment market. Regulatory incentives including tax credits, extended exclusivity periods, and waived fees are encouraging pharmaceutical companies to invest in rare disease therapies. The global orphan drug market is projected to grow at nearly 12% annually, outpacing the broader pharmaceutical sector. Companies like Ultragenyx Pharmaceutical have leveraged these incentives to develop novel therapies, with their recombinant human alkaline phosphatase product showing promising results in clinical trials for hypophosphatasia, a related metabolic disorder.

The FDA's approval of burosumab in 2018 marked a turning point in hypophosphatemia treatment, demonstrating the potential for biologic therapies in addressing this condition more effectively than traditional phosphate and vitamin D supplements.

Furthermore, increased healthcare expenditure in emerging economies and improved diagnostic capabilities are enabling earlier detection of hypophosphatemia, creating a larger addressable market for treatment options. Telemedicine platforms are also improving access to specialized care for patients in remote areas who might otherwise go undiagnosed.

MARKET RESTRAINTS

High Treatment Costs and Limited Reimbursement Policies to Hinder Market Penetration

While novel biologic treatments show promising efficacy, their high cost creates significant barriers to widespread adoption. Burosumab treatment for XLH can exceed $150,000 annually, placing it out of reach for many patients without comprehensive insurance coverage. In developing nations where healthcare budgets are constrained, such pricing models make these treatments effectively inaccessible. Even in developed markets, payer pushback and complex prior authorization requirements delay treatment initiation for many eligible patients.

Additional Constraints

Diagnostic Challenges
Hypophosphatemia often presents with non-specific symptoms like muscle weakness and bone pain, leading to misdiagnosis or delayed diagnosis. Many primary care physicians lack familiarity with rare forms of the condition, resulting in average diagnostic delays of 3-5 years for genetic hypophosphatemia cases. This lag time between symptom onset and proper diagnosis significantly impacts the addressable patient pool.

Adverse Effects of Conventional Therapies
Traditional treatments using oral phosphate supplements and active vitamin D analogs can cause nephrocalcinosis and secondary hyperparathyroidism with long-term use. These safety concerns discourage some clinicians from aggressive treatment, particularly in pediatric populations where growth disturbances may occur. The need for frequent monitoring also increases the overall treatment burden on healthcare systems.

MARKET OPPORTUNITIES

Emerging Pipeline Therapies and Precision Medicine Approaches to Create Growth Potential

The hypophosphatemia treatment landscape is poised for transformation with several novel therapies in late-stage clinical development. Investigational drugs targeting different pathways in phosphate metabolism, such as inhibitors of fibroblast growth factor 23 (FGF23), could provide alternative treatment options for patients. Precision medicine approaches leveraging genetic testing are enabling more targeted therapeutic strategies, particularly for hereditary forms of hypophosphatemia where specific mutations can be identified.

Biopharmaceutical companies are increasingly focusing on pediatric formulations to address the unmet needs of children with genetic hypophosphatemic disorders. The development of age-appropriate dosage forms and administration methods could significantly improve treatment adherence and outcomes in this vulnerable population. Additionally, the integration of digital health tools for monitoring serum phosphate levels and treatment response is creating opportunities for tech-pharma collaborations.

Expansion in Emerging Markets Through Strategic Partnerships

With healthcare infrastructure improving in developing regions, pharmaceutical companies are exploring market expansion strategies through local partnerships. Collaborative efforts with regional manufacturers can help overcome cost barriers through localized production and distribution. Several Asian countries are implementing rare disease policies and patient registries, creating more favorable environments for introducing novel hypophosphatemia treatments. These markets could account for over 30% of future growth as diagnosis rates improve and economic conditions allow for greater healthcare spending.

MARKET CHALLENGES

Limited Patient Pool and Diagnostic Uncertainty to Impede Market Growth

Despite significant unmet needs, the relatively small patient population for genetic hypophosphatemia disorders creates commercial challenges for drug developers. The orphan drug model depends on premium pricing to justify development costs, but payers are increasingly scrutinizing cost-effectiveness analyses for ultra-rare conditions. This tension between affordability and innovation creates uncertainty for companies considering entry into the hypophosphatemia treatment space.

Operational Challenges

Complex Manufacturing Requirements
Biologic therapies for hypophosphatemia require sophisticated manufacturing processes with stringent quality control measures. Many of these treatments involve complex recombinant proteins that are sensitive to production conditions, leading to higher failure rates and supply chain vulnerabilities. The specialized expertise required for these processes limits the number of contract manufacturing organizations capable of producing these therapies reliably.

Regulatory Variability Across Regions
Divergent regulatory pathways for orphan drugs in different countries create barriers to global market access. While some regions offer accelerated approval mechanisms for rare disease treatments, others maintain more conventional requirements that delay availability. This inconsistency forces companies to implement market-by-market strategies rather than pursuing simultaneous global launches, slowing overall market growth.

Regional Analysis: Hypophosphatemia Treatment Market

North America
The North American hypophosphatemia treatment market is the largest globally, driven by advanced healthcare infrastructure, high awareness of rare diseases, and strong regulatory support. The U.S. FDA has approved therapies such as Kyowa Kirin’s Crysvita® (burosumab), significantly boosting treatment accessibility. Rising diagnosis rates of chronic kidney disease (CKD) and genetic disorders like X-linked hypophosphatemia (XLH) are key growth contributors. However, stringent reimbursement policies and the high cost of biologics (averaging $150,000-$300,000 annually per patient) pose adoption challenges. The region hosts leading players like Ultragenyx Pharmaceutical, fostering innovation in phosphate-regulating therapies.

Europe
Europe’s market thrives under the EU’s centralized drug approval system, with EMA-approved therapies benefiting from cross-border accessibility. Countries like Germany and France prioritize rare disease treatments through national healthcare coverage, though pricing negotiations with agencies like NICE (UK) can delay market entry. The region’s aging population amplifies CKD-linked hypophosphatemia cases, creating sustained demand. Recent developments include Kyowa Kirin’s expansion of Crysvita® indications for tumor-induced osteomalacia. However, fragmented reimbursement policies across member states and budget constraints in Southern Europe limit uniform growth.

Asia-Pacific
This fastest-growing market benefits from rising healthcare expenditure and improving diagnostic capabilities. Japan leads in innovation, with domestic firms like Kyowa Kirin spearheading biologic production. China and India show surging demand due to large CKD patient pools but face hurdles like poor rural healthcare access and price sensitivity favoring generic phosphorous supplements. Local players like Nanjing Jianyou Biochemical Pharmaceutical are gaining traction with cost-effective alternatives. Regulatory harmonization initiatives (e.g., ASEAN Joint Assessment) aim to accelerate novel therapy approvals, yet affordability remains a persistent barrier.

South America
Market growth here is moderate and uneven, with Brazil and Argentina dominating due to relatively stable healthcare systems. Public healthcare programs provide basic phosphate salts, but advanced therapies (e.g., burosumab) are scarce outside private sectors. Economic volatility and currency fluctuations disrupt consistent drug supply chains. Recent developments include Argentina’s inclusion of hypophosphatemia in its rare disease registry, potentially improving treatment access. However, inadequate diagnostic infrastructure in smaller economies like Paraguay and Bolivia stifles market expansion.

Middle East & Africa
The MEA market remains nascent but opportunistic. Gulf nations (UAE, Saudi Arabia) drive growth through hospital investments and rare disease funding initiatives. South Africa has emerging capabilities for managing severe hypophosphatemia cases. Challenges include low awareness, inadequate specialist coverage, and political instability in parts of Africa delaying healthcare reforms. Biosimilar adoption is rising as a cost-effective measure, though regulatory frameworks lag behind global standards. Long-term potential exists as governments increasingly prioritize non-communicable disease management.
